Description
The Product Manager is responsible for the strategy, roadmap, and success of key solutions within the Enterprise Corrections Suite. The portfolio includes solutions supporting inmate financial management, commissary operations, inmate communications, digital engagement, tablets, messaging, video visitation, kiosks, payments, and related correctional services. Working closely with customers, business stakeholders, development teams, and leadership, the Product Manager identifies opportunities, validates customer needs, and delivers solutions that create measurable value for correctional agencies and Tyler Technologies.
